1571528da3 dlopen shared library symlink using major version name.
cffi.dlopen should use .so.N symlinks instead of .so to
make sure we load ABI compatible version of the library and
the same library used by the rest of the system.

cffi uses `ctypes.util.find_library` to search for libraries
and the docs for `find_library` states that
"The exact functionality is system dependent."
so different system may expect different names for the same library.

To overcome that problem we try to load several names until success
among these names exact file name with `.so` suffix
eg. `libcairo.so` but .so symlink is not always safe to use.

Shared library usually consist of two of three files:
- libcairo.so.N.M - N.M exact version number
- libcairo.so.N - symlink to library.so.N.M with major ABI version
- libcairo.so - symlink to library.so.N

When -lcairo flag is used linker search for libcairo.so,
but when the programm loaded it loads libcairo.so.N where N
is the version that it was linked with.

Some downsides of .so usage:
- .so may point to the wrong ABI version, e.g. we expect libcairo
  version 2 but libcairo.so points at libcairo.so.1
- usually .so files are shipped with development packages `-dev`
  in debian and `-devel` in centos and they are just symlinks
  to the .so.N files. So it safer to search for .so.N files they
  will exist even if dev package is not installed.
- hard symlink .so -> .so.N not always preserved, eg. if we zip
  them we get two copies of the library and while the rest of the
  system will use .so.N file we will load .so files that may lead
  to crash

736639dfcb Fix condition avoiding line recalculation
At the end of a linebox layout, we have to check that the new linebox has the
same position as the originally calculated one. If the position is different,
it means that a floating element needs to push the linebox to a lower position.

With ltr lines, the box horizontal position is calculated related to the left
border of the box. It’s different with rtl lines, because the left border has
to be translated to the left each time the linebox width changes. We thus need
to rely on the right border for rtl lines.

1be85621a5 Don't calculate linebox width and height when not needed
Float clearance requires to calculate the line minimum width and height before
setting the linebox position. When there are no floating boxes in the context,
there's no need to calculate these sizes.

We thus avoid a call to inline_min_content_width per text line. This call
required a lot of time as it needed to go through the whole line breaking
algorithm to render the first word.

We save 15% of the rendering time when generating our Odyssey sample.
